Banks
There are 8 bank branches of different Chinese Banks in Chuxiong, including main banks as Bank of China, ICBC, Bank of Construction, Bank of Communications, Bank of Agriculture and so on. In these places, US and Euro traveler’s checks, Visa Card, Master Card can be cashed. Additionally, each branch has an ATM which will be available for foreign cards such as Visa Card, Master Card or Cirrus network.
It is acceptable for opening an account in a bank for international students in Chuxiong. All of the information will be provided during the orientation.
Electricity
The voltage of electricity in China is 220 V, 50 Hz of AC. For any workable appliances that work below this voltage, it is appreciative of using a voltage adaptor before switch on electricity. As for plugs and switch board, the following five types will be workable: three-pronged angled pins (like in Australia), three-pronged round pins (like in Singapore), two flat pins (like in North America), two narrow round pins (like in Europe), and three rectangular pins (like in the UK).
Health
Medical services are cheap in Chuixong. Next to the international students and teachers building, there is a clinic for University use only. Besides, living facilities are available and convenient. A water dispenser, a machine of 20-25 liter bottle of drinking water and house delivery, will be available for students and teachers. The cost of each bottle of drinking water is about ¥5 – 6 yuan (RBM). It is recommended that students and teachers buy a health insurance before coming to China, and also make sure that your insurance covers repatriation costs, if needed. Finally, a guidance book of living in Chuxiong will be given at the time of Orientation, which will cover some basic rules to get away some common problems and unnecessary troubles.
Holidays
China has 10 National Holidays which will be available at CNU:
They are:
- January 1st, the New Year’s Day
- February, Spring Festival (Chinese New Year’s Day, according to Lunar Calendar)
- March 8th, International Women’s Day
- April 15th, Prefectural Holiday of Yi People in Chuxiong
- May 1st, International Labor’s Day
- June 1st, International Children’s Day
- July 1st, Chinese Communist Party’s Day
- August 1st, Anniversary of the Founding of the PLA
- September 10th, Teacher’s Day
- October 1st, National Day
In addition to these holidays, there are three days off for Chuxiong Prefectual Holiday. There is one day off for May Day (International Labor’s Day) , National Day and Mid-Autumn Day. The Mid-Autumn Festival comes to on the 15th of August according to Chinese Lunar Calendar during the full moon of mid-autumn. The Torch Festival is also celebrated in Chuxiong, which is a day of Yi people on the 24th of June according to Yi People’s Calendar. It usually falls in June or July each year.
Internet
There are several large chargeable computer rooms on campus, which is available for all staff members on campus. In addition, there are several surfing rooms for using internet near campus and downtown, and are fairly cheap. It charges one or two Yuan an hour, and is opened every day according to timetable. Otherwise, with a total cost of 30 Yuan (¥RMB) per month, the 24-hour accommodation line for students and teachers in plat will be more convenient.

Restaurants
Dining is convenient in Chuxiong. Eating out in Chuxiong is dispensable but appreciative depending on one’s own plan. Chinese cuisine is a quite experience especially for people from abroad. Most restaurants serve Chinese food, few serve Western foods as pizza and so or forth. Around the campus, there are several cheap eateries, where different choices and appetite can be attained. There are also a number of cafés in town where all sorts of teas, brewed coffee and food are served.
Shopping
Most things are readily available in Chuxiong, with the exception of some Western food which can only be bought in Kunming or be delivered from Kunming within one day. There are many vegetable markets in town.
Transportation
Chuxiong is a small town. One may walk to get most places from the University. There is an extensive and efficient network of local bus which runs from the early hours of the day till late night. Additionally, taxi and mini buses are fair choices with a charge of one Yuan. Usually, the charge of taxi within town is ¥5 yuan (RMB).
Climate
Obviously, the weather in Chuxiong is pleasant, as its subtropical climate, dry in winter and wet in summer. The annual average temperature is about 200 C, and the yearly rainfall is about 826 mm. The rainfall season is from May to October. Just as many people tell about Yunnan: “Four seasons goes in one place, mountain top cold, valley hot. One day makes different seasons: day hot and night cold. Different skies may alter from one li apart.” The same weather can be experienced in Chuxiong.
